amiss

/əˈmɪs/

noun

  1. Fault; wrong; an evil act, a bad deed.

adjective

  1. Wrong; faulty; out of order; improper or otherwise incorrect.

    "He suspected something was amiss."

adverb

  1. Wrongly.

  2. Mistakenly.

  3. Astray.

  4. Imperfectly.
